if the discharge is not clear/white and not smelly then theres nothing wrong, but otherwise speak to your doctor/midwife and they might need to do a smear test to find out whats going on. i had thrush (yeast infection) while pregnant and i wasnt worried because although it wasnt clear, it wasnt smelly either! and it itched like mad aswell. it took me weeks before i mentioned it to my midwife and she did a smear test and gave me a cream for it. its best to mention it to a health professional if you're worried

Green discharge usually means an infection...not everyone experience every symptoms (i.e. not smelly). I would get checked by the dr just to make sure.
Rosejackson above said that if its not clear or white then there is nothign wrong...that is false...if its not clear or white...there is something wrong. Clear white discharge is the OK one.
